| /** |
| * Base class containing information common to all package items held by |
| * the package manager. This provides a very common basic set of attributes: |
| * a label, icon, and meta-data. This class is not intended |
| * to be used by itself; it is simply here to share common definitions |
| * between all items returned by the package manager. As such, it does not |
| * itself implement Parcelable, but does provide convenience methods to assist |
| * in the implementation of Parcelable in subclasses. |
| */ |
| @android.ravenwood.annotation.RavenwoodKeepWholeClass |
| public class PackageItemInfo { |

| /** |
| * Public name of this item. From the "android:name" attribute. |
| */ |
| public String name; |
| |
| /** |
| * Name of the package that this item is in. |
| */ |
| public String packageName; |
| |
| /** |
| * A string resource identifier (in the package's resources) of this |
| * component's label. From the "label" attribute or, if not set, 0. |
| */ |
| public int labelRes; |
| |
| /** |
| * The string provided in the AndroidManifest file, if any. You |
| * probably don't want to use this. You probably want |
| * {@link PackageManager#getApplicationLabel} |
| */ |
| public CharSequence nonLocalizedLabel; |
| |
| /** |
| * A drawable resource identifier (in the package's resources) of this |
| * component's icon. From the "icon" attribute or, if not set, 0. |
| */ |
| public int icon; |
| |
| /** |
| * A drawable resource identifier (in the package's resources) of this |
| * component's banner. From the "banner" attribute or, if not set, 0. |
| */ |
| public int banner; |
| |
| /** |
| * A drawable resource identifier (in the package's resources) of this |
| * component's logo. Logos may be larger/wider than icons and are |
| * displayed by certain UI elements in place of a name or name/icon |
| * combination. From the "logo" attribute or, if not set, 0. |
| */ |
| public int logo; |
| |
| /** |
| * Additional meta-data associated with this component. This field |
| * will only be filled in if you set the |
| * {@link PackageManager#GET_META_DATA} flag when requesting the info. |
| */ |
| public Bundle metaData; |
| |
| /** |
| * If different of UserHandle.USER_NULL, The icon of this item will represent that user. |
| * @hide |
| */ |
| public int showUserIcon; |
| |
| /** |
| * Whether the package is currently in an archived state. |
| * |
| * <p>Packages can be archived through {@link PackageInstaller#requestArchive} and do not have |
| * any APKs stored on the device, but do keep the data directory. |
| * |
| */ |
| @FlaggedApi(Flags.FLAG_ARCHIVING) |
| public boolean isArchived; |

| /** |
| * Retrieve the current textual label associated with this item. This |
| * will call back on the given PackageManager to load the label from |
| * the application. |
| * |
| * @param pm A PackageManager from which the label can be loaded; usually |
| * the PackageManager from which you originally retrieved this item. |
| * |
| * @return Returns a CharSequence containing the item's label. If the |
| * item does not have a label, its name is returned. |
| */ |
| @android.ravenwood.annotation.RavenwoodThrow(blockedBy = android.content.res.Resources.class) |
| public @NonNull CharSequence loadLabel(@NonNull PackageManager pm) { |
| if (sForceSafeLabels && !Objects.equals(packageName, ActivityThread.currentPackageName())) { |
| return loadSafeLabel(pm, DEFAULT_MAX_LABEL_SIZE_PX, SAFE_STRING_FLAG_TRIM |
| | SAFE_STRING_FLAG_FIRST_LINE); |
| } else { |
| // Trims the label string to the MAX_SAFE_LABEL_LENGTH. This is to prevent that the |
| // system is overwhelmed by an enormous string returned by the application. |
| return TextUtils.trimToSize(loadUnsafeLabel(pm), MAX_SAFE_LABEL_LENGTH); |
| } |
| } |
| |
| /** {@hide} */ |
| @android.ravenwood.annotation.RavenwoodThrow(blockedBy = android.content.res.Resources.class) |
| public CharSequence loadUnsafeLabel(PackageManager pm) { |
| if (nonLocalizedLabel != null) { |
| return nonLocalizedLabel; |
| } |
| if (labelRes != 0) { |
| CharSequence label = pm.getText(packageName, labelRes, getApplicationInfo()); |
| if (label != null) { |
| return label.toString().trim(); |
| } |
| } |
| if (name != null) { |
| return name; |
| } |
| return packageName; |
| } |
